  • Patent number: 7765963
    Abstract: An internal combustion engine usable for producing a rotational output, the internal combustion engine comprising: a casing; a cylinder defining a cylinder head and a combustion chamber extending from the cylinder head, the combustion chamber being substantially arc segment shaped and defining a chamber radius of curvature, the cylinder being mounted to the casing so as to be movable relatively thereto along a substantially annular path extending in a substantially concentric relationship relatively to the combustion chamber, the substantially annular path having a path radius of curvature substantially similar to the chamber radius of curvature; a piston, the piston being operatively coupled to the cylinder so as to be reciprocatingly movable within the combustion chamber, the piston being mounted to the casing so as to be movable relatively thereto along the substantially annular path; an output element operatively coupled to the cylinder and to the piston for producing the rotational output; and a unidirec
    Type: Grant
    Filed: February 5, 2007
    Date of Patent: August 3, 2010
    Inventor: Jean-Marc Tardif
